GM Performance Display

General Motors (GM) has come up with its own performance display that is meant to be used in tandem with ECOtec engines, especially turbocharged ones. They will be available as an option from early next year onwards, retailing for $295 a pop in a dealer installed package. Dubbed the Reconfigurable Performance Display, you will be able to view a vast array of data in gauge form, including boost, battery voltage, air fuel ratio, cam phase angle, timing, barometric pressure and torque and horsepower.
